Abstract

The invention provides a sugar composition for use in the manufacture of foodstuffs, said composition comprising a suspension of a fine sugar having a mean particle size of less than 30 microns in glucose syrup. This composition allows for energy efficient production of products including frappe, and methods as well as apparatus used in these methods form further aspects of the invention.

Claims

exact text as granted — not AI-modified
1 . A sugar composition for use in the manufacture of foodstuffs, said composition comprising a suspension of a fine sugar having a mean particle size of less than 30 microns in glucose syrup. 
     
     
         2 . The sugar composition of  claim 1 , which consists of a suspension of a fine sugar having a mean particle size of less than 30 microns in glucose syrup. 
     
     
         3 . The sugar composition of  claim 1 , wherein the fine sugar is a refined sucrose. 
     
     
         4 . The sugar composition of  claim 1 , in which the fine sugar has a mean particle size of 5-25 microns. 
     
     
         5 . The sugar composition of  claim 1 , wherein the fine sugar has a mean particle size of from 10-15 microns. 
     
     
         6 . The sugar composition of  claim 1 , wherein the glucose syrup has a DE value in the range of from 35-95. 
     
     
         7 . The sugar composition of  claim 1 , wherein the ratio of glucose syrup to fine sugar in the composition is in the range of from 3:1 to 1:3. 
     
     
         8 - 10 . (canceled) 
     
     
         11 . A method for producing frappe, said method comprising preparing a sugar composition comprising a suspension of a fine sugar having a mean particle size of less than 30 microns in glucose syrup, mixing the sugar composition with a formulation comprising a protein to provide a mixture and aerating the mixture. 
     
     
         12 . The method of  claim 11 , wherein the protein formulation comprises powdered egg, milk protein or a mixture thereof. 
     
     
         13 . The method of  claim 11 , wherein the formulation comprising protein is present in the mixture in an amount of from 2-20% w/w. 
     
     
         14 . The method of  claim 11 , wherein the frappe is aerated by dispersing air into the mixture under pressure. 
     
     
         15 . The method of  claim 13 , wherein the frappe is aerated using a pressure beater. 
     
     
         16 . The method of  claim 11 , wherein the aerated mixture is heated under pressure so as to stabilize the frappe. 
     
     
         17 - 24 . (canceled) 
     
     
         25 . An apparatus for preparing a sugar composition comprising a suspension of a fine sugar having a mean particle size of less than 30 microns in glucose syrup comprising a container, a mixer comprising a series of rotating blades arranged in the container such that material added to an end region of the container is transported along it while being mixed, a first pipe or tube, operably disposed relative to a storage device for fine sugar and the container, a second pipe or tube operably disposed relative to a storage device for glucose syrup and the container, a control system operably disposed to adjustable valves further operably disposed relative to the first and second pipe or tube.
